A characterization of qubit quantum channels is introduced. In analogy to what happens in the context of Bosonic channels we exploit the possibility of representing the states of the system in terms of characteristic function. The latter are functions of non-commuting variables (Grassmann variables) and are defined in terms of generalized displacement operators. In this context we introduce the set of Gaussian channels and show that they share similar properties with the corresponding Bosonic counterpart.
